编写app要什么知识
2025-02-24 10:04:40 财经新闻
编写一款成功的应用程序(A)需要掌握哪些知识?这不仅仅是对编程技能的考验,更是一个全面的知识整合过程。下面,我们就来详细探讨一下,编写A所需具备的各类知识。
一、编程语言知识
1.熟练掌握至少一种编程语言,如Java、Swift、Kotlin等,这是编写A的基础。
2.了解不同编程语言的特点和应用场景,以便根据需求选择合适的语言。二、界面设计知识
1.熟悉界面设计原则,如简洁、美观、易用等。
2.掌握至少一种界面设计工具,如Sketch、Figma等。
3.了解用户体验(UX)和用户界面(UI)设计,提升A的用户满意度。三、数据库知识
1.熟悉数据库的基本概念和操作,如SQL语言。
2.了解关系型数据库和非关系型数据库的特点和应用场景。四、网络知识
1.了解网络协议,如HTT、HTTS等。
2.熟悉网络编程,如TC/I、WeSocket等。五、版本控制知识
1.熟练使用版本控制工具,如Git。
2.了解代码管理的基本原则和方法。六、跨平台开发知识
1.了解跨平台开发框架,如Flutter、ReactNative等。
2.掌握不同平台的开发工具和运行环境。七、测试与调试知识
1.熟悉测试方法,如单元测试、集成测试等。
2.掌握调试技巧,提高代码质量。八、市场营销知识
1.了解A市场现状和趋势。
2.掌握A推广策略,如应用商店优化(ASO)、社交媒体营销等。九、法律法规知识
1.了解A相关的法律法规,如数据保护法、隐私政策等。
2.遵守***法律法规,确保A合规运营。十、项目管理知识
1.了解项目管理的基本原则和方法。
2.提高团队协作能力,确保项目顺利进行。十一、持续学习与自我提升
1.关注行业动态,紧跟技术发展趋势。
2.不断学习新知识、新技能,提升自身竞争力。编写一款成功的A需要掌握多种知识,从编程语言到界面设计,从数据库到网络,再到市场营销和法律法规等。只有全面掌握这些知识,才能在激烈的市场竞争中脱颖而出。
- 上一篇:美的冰箱售后怎么样